Signs You May Need HVAC Repair or Replacement

An HVAC system that's not working properly or outdated likely needs professional attention for repairs or replacement. Watch for these signals that your system needs service:

  • Poor air circulation or uneven heating/cooling
  • Odd noises when the system turns on
  • Rust, corrosion, or cracking
  • Higher than normal energy bills
  • Refrigerant leaks
  • Frequent breakdowns and need for repairs
  • Thermostat malfunctions or temperature control issues
  • An HVAC system that's over 15 years old

If you see any of these HVAC issues, we recommend having a technician inspect your system. A local professional can detect problems and decide whether repairing or getting a new HVAC unit is the best solution.

Cost of HVAC Installation and Maintenance in Lehigh Acres

Your HVAC installation or maintenance cost changes depending on the type of unit. Common HVAC unit types include the following:

  • Split or mini-split: If your home lacks the right ductwork for central air or heating, you probably have a split HVAC system. Split or mini-split systems consist of internal units that control the temperature in individual rooms. These interior units are all connected to an outdoor unit.
  • Hybrid split: A hybrid split HVAC system operates similar to a normal split system, but has the advantage of being able to draw power from either electric or gas sources.
  • Heat pump: Heat pumps exchange hot and cold air between your house and outside. They don't create their own heating and cooling, so they work best in more mild climates and may not be as effective during Lehigh Acres' hot summers.
  • Packaged heating and air: Packaged HVAC systems work best in smaller homes. They consist of a single combined heating and air conditioning unit, typically located in an attic or basement. This unit is typically small, energy-efficient, and straightforward to maintain.

Ways to Save Money on HVAC Costs

It's important to fix or swap out your HVAC components when they become damaged, but it can also be expensive. Fortunately, there are some steps you can take to reduce wear and tear on your HVAC.

  • Monitor for potential problems. Keeping an eye out for problems, for instance by routinely checking your thermostat and energy bills, allows you to resolve them before they get out of hand.
  • Keep your system clean. Keeping your condenser fan blades, ductwork, grills, and indoor evaporator coil clean helps your system run and reduces the chance of mold growth. The National Air Duct Cleaners Association recommends that you clean your HVAC system when it starts to look dirty.
  • Change the position of your blinds seasonally. Leaving your blinds open during the winter helps warm your home with passive solar heating. Closing the blinds in warmer seasons helps prevent the heat from getting inside. Doing both helps decrease the demand on your HVAC.
  • Change filters regularly. Air flows most effectively through your HVAC system when you change out or clean the filters every 30–90 days. Also try not to let debris pile up on the outdoor parts of your HVAC.

How To Choose a Local HVAC Company

It's important to know what makes a good HVAC company. A properly licensed contractor with the right experience will give you confidence that they can fix your system, providing you with effective air conditioning and heating for your home.

Compare Multiple Bids

Contact at least three HVAC companies for quotes. Explain your issues and schedule an in-person inspection if possible. Compare companies' diagnoses, suggested repairs, estimated costs, warranties, and timeframes. Avoid providers that pressure you or demand upfront payment.

Check Credentials

Look for an HVAC company that employs qualified technicians who have the necessary licensure and training. HVAC contractors in all states need to obtain a Section 608 Technician Certification from the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A). This certification is mandatory for all contractors who "maintain, service, repair or dispose of equipment that could release refrigerants into the atmosphere." Contractors must pass an exam (the type of exam depends on the type of equipment they intend to work with) to be certified by the EPA. All other licensing requirements are handled on a state-by-state basis.

In Florida, HVAC contractors must be registered or certified with the Department of Business and Professional Regulation. Certified HVAC contractors need to have four years of experience, pass an exam, and have HVAC business insurance. Registered HVAC contractors may only work in a specific city, and the local government establishes licensing requirements. You should also check reviews and complaints on sites like Google Reviews, the Better Business Bureau (BBB), and Yelp. Choose a company with positive reviews and testimonials about fantastic customer experiences.

Understand Work Details

It’s important to understand what the work process is going to look like. For HVAC repairs, the company should explain the particular parts that need replacement and why. Get confirmation that your technician will clean and test the full system afterward to ensure proper functioning. When replacing your HVAC, request that the company explain the new features, brand, model, estimated installation time, and energy efficiency. Before signing paperwork, be sure you understand the process your provider will use to size the new HVAC system appropriately for your home and what the price will be.

Compare Warranties

A reputable HVAC company will back its repair work and installations with a warranty. The longer and more comprehensive the coverage terms, the better. Carefully compare warranty terms between contractors and choose the provider that offers the best protection at a reasonable price.

Get Quote in Writing

Get a written quote before HVAC work begins. A comprehensive quote includes both materials and labor costs. Make sure you understand and agree to all terms before signing the contract.

Frequently Asked Questions About HVAC in Lehigh Acres, FL

You should have your HVAC system inspected approximately twice yearly. After the inspection, your technician will tell you what services are required. You should also schedule an inspection if you start noticing issues such as strange noises, leaks, or unusual smells. If your system has ductwork, it should be inspected every few years.

Usually, you should schedule inspections in the spring and fall, as these times tend to be less busy. This also helps make sure your system is prepared for the summer and winter, when it probably sees the most use.

You can save energy during the summer by reducing the amount of power your HVAC system uses to keep your home cool. Keep your thermostat temperature as close to the outside temperature as is comfortable, and avoid making drastic changes in temperature all at once. Keep your roof well-maintained and seal any leaks around your windows and doors to avoid letting cool air escape. Similarly, make sure your attic is well ventilated to avoid trapping excess heat in your home.

It takes between one and three days to have your HVAC system installed or replaced. If you only need an air conditioning unit or a furnace, this might take between half a day and two days. This timeline will be determined by the size of your house, the accessibility of your system, and any issues your technician discovers.

For a 2,000-square-foot home, you'll need between 2.5 and 5 tons of air conditioning capacity. In Lehigh Acres, you'll probably want to purchase a unit on the higher end of this range. For homes over 1,000 square feet, central air will be more effective for cooling than window units.

For a 2,000-square-foot home, you'll also look for a furnace that is between 50,000 and 80,000 BTUs (British thermal units). In Lehigh Acres, you might be able to make do with a lower-capacity furnace.

There are a number of ways you can make your HVAC system more energy-efficient:

  • Keep ductwork clean, and clean or change your air filters regularly.
  • Have regular inspections to take care of problems as they come up.
  • Make sure your doors and windows are well-sealed and keep your attic well-ventilated.
  • Install a smart thermostat. If you aren't able to purchase one, try keeping your inside temperature as close to the outside temperature as you can.
  • When it comes time to replace any part of your HVAC system, explore Energy Star-certified or other environmentally friendly options.
